Levokab Information

Levokab is a prescription medicine that is available as a Tablet. Urinary Tract Infection, Prostatitis, Pneumonia are some of its major therapeutic uses. The alternative uses of Levokab have also been explained below.

The optimal dosage of Levokab is largely dependent on the individual's body weight, medical history, gender and age. The condition it has been prescribed for, and the route of administration also determine the right dosage. Refer to the dosage section for a detailed discussion.

Some other side effects of Levokab have been listed ahead. Such side effects of Levokab normally do not last long and go away once the treatment is completed. If, however, they worsen or do not go away, please speak with your physician.

In addition, Levokab's effect is Moderate during pregnancy and Severe for lactating mothers. It is important to know if Levokab has any effect on the kidney, liver and heart. Information on such adverse effects, if any, has been given in the Levokab related warnings section.

Levokab can cause adverse effects in certain medical conditions. It is strongly recommended to avoid Levokab in conditions like Coronary Artery Disease (CAD), Heart Disease, Myasthenia Gravis (MG). Other conditions have been mentioned below in the Levokab contraindications section.

Besides this, Levokab may also have severe interaction with some medicines. See below for a complete list.

In addition to the above precautions for Levokab, it is important to know that it is not safe while driving, and is not habit-forming.

What is Levokab?

Dr. Madhur Anand MBBS, MS , General Surgery

Levokab is a brand name of levofloxacin. It is a prescription drug that belongs to the class of medication called fluoroquinolones. It is a broad spectrum antibiotic, used for treating bacterial infections, such as bronchitis, pneumonia, urinary, respiratory, skin, gastrointestinal, anthrax, bone, and eye infections.
